We booked an 11-day/10-night self-drive camping trip across Namibia with Firefinch Safaris & Car Hire and it exceeded every expectation.

From the moment we landed, everything was seamless: we were collected at the airport and taken to Bluu Car Hire where the team handed over our fully equipped Toyota Hilux 4x4 – rooftop tents, fridge, complete camping kit – all spotless and perfectly prepared. When the fridge stopped working at Spitzkoppe, the team drove out the same day to fix it on the spot. That level of service is unheard of – absolutely amazing!

At Urban Camp we were met by the wonderful Gesa, who gave us a thorough briefing, fantastic driving tips, hidden-gem recommendations and made us feel completely looked after from day one. She stayed in touch every single day via WhatsApp – quick replies, extra suggestions, and genuine care that made the whole trip stress-free. Thank you, Gesa – you’re a total star!

The itinerary was flawless:
Urban Camp (Windhoek) → Otjiwa Eagle’s Rest → Onguma Tamboti (loved the pool after Etosha game drives!) → Okaukuejo → Spitzkoppe (magical – a grown-up playground among the boulders, wish we’d stayed longer) → Alte Brücke Swakopmund → Sossus Oasis (perfect base for early dune climbs) → Bagatelle Kalahari Game Ranch (red dunes, cheetah sightings, horses wandering through camp and the best dinner of the trip!).
Every campsite was excellent, bookings were perfect, and the route flowed beautifully.
